作 者:尹晓静[1] 赵长喜[1] 王宁[1] 卢玉灵[2] 赵阳[1] 魏开鹏[1]
机构地区:[1]中国石化河南油田分公司石油工程研究院,南阳473132 [2]中国石化河南油田分公司采油一厂,南阳474780
出 处:《精细石油化工进展》2008年第10期4-6,共3页Advances in Fine Petrochemicals
摘 要:以硅酸盐结构形成剂、高活性微晶增强剂、活性超微粉增强剂、玻璃纤维增韧剂、JB-1型触变调节剂和缓速剂等复配制备了 HS-1封窜剂,确定了封窜剂浆液最佳水灰比为0.6—0.9,JB-1型触变调节剂最佳加量为0.3%-0.4%。评价实验表明,该封窜剂具有较强的触变性、驻留性、封堵性和抗压性能。现场应用表明,该封窜技术可以有效封堵管外窜槽,截止目前,该技术已累计现场应用11井次,工艺成功率100%,有效率100%,累计增油量10 376.2 t,降水量26 872.1 m^3,增油效果显著。The HS - 1 channeling sealing agent was prepared using structure - forming agent, high - active reinforcing agent, fiberglass flexibilizer, JB- 1 thixotropic agent, and retardant, etc. Optimal water/solid ratio of the channeling sealing agent slurry and dosage of JB - 1 thixotropic agent were determined, respectively 0.6 -0.9, 0.3% -0.4%. Evaluation result indicated that the channeling sealing agent has high compressive strength, good residing property and thixotropy, strong blocking capability, and so on. The field application indicated the technology could seal outer interzonal channels validly. So far, this technology had been used in 11 wells, the success ratio is 100% and the efficiency ratio is 100% too, the increment of oil production is 10 376.2 t and the descendent of water production is 26 872.1 m^3, and the application effect is prominent.
